African scientists rally for equity in climate research

Environment CS Soipan Tuya (in red) with delegates during the launch of the IPCC 7th assessment cycle for Kenya. [Courtesy]

Kenyan climate scientists have taken a bold stance to address the underrepresentation of African voices in climate research.

This comes against a backdrop of the global scientific community that has long recognised the urgent need for comprehensive climate research and action, yet there remains a persistent gap in the representation and participation of African scientists.
